Output 81b1f90225c781337a21f005461ac02ab637fd44f77929f66f480c03e64256c3:1

value
5000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0363cb62836694c3291bb5847e1379e04b3340ec OP_EQUALVERIFY OP_CHECKSIG
address
D5T27g8JFv2sxxyP3My9u6guCfYGveoPHX
transaction
81b1f90225c781337a21f005461ac02ab637fd44f77929f66f480c03e64256c3